## Ordwell Checkout — Environments

Load tests for the checkout flow run only in the `perf` environment, which mirrors prod topology at half scale. Reviewers should confirm any PR touching payment handlers includes a perf run link. Staging is not suitable for load work; its database is shared. The perf environment uses the configuration values below.

service settings:
[kelix]
port = 8443
region = south-3
host = kelix.halixforge.test
team = holius
timeout_ms = 2000
retries = 3

Step 4: Enable the Broadhelm large-file diff viewer. Reviews of files over 20 MB now render through the chunked viewer instead of inline diffs. No reviewer action is needed beyond refreshing cached pages. The viewer stores chunk indexes in its own schema, so point it at the metadata database using the following connection string.

replica DSN, tawef-hahap: mysql://eliix_svc:FiIC0jz@db-394a.lumiclabs.internal:5432/holius

Plugin authors: every event your plugin emits must reference a
# schema version registered here before publish, and the registry caches
# compatibility checks aggressively to keep hot paths fast. Changing these
# values affects cache lifetime, negotiation retries, and the size of the
# local schema snapshot, so coordinate with the platform team before
# overriding them in a plugin manifest. The defaults, chosen after load
# testing on the Thistledown cluster, are given below.

limits module of tafop-hahop:
WEIGHTS = {
    "julmir": 223,
    "belox": 987,
    "lamion": 470,
    "pelath": 609,
    "fraok": 1010,
    "eliion": 343,
    "drudor": 342,
}